Frequently asked questions

Is Phuket cheaper than Glendale?

Yes. Phuket has a cost of living index of 52 vs 93 for Glendale (100 = US average). That's about 44% cheaper.

How much will I save moving from Glendale to Phuket?

On a $75K salary, moving from Glendale to Phuket saves roughly $756/month on core expenses. That's ~$9,072/year.

What salary do I need in Phuket to match my Glendale lifestyle?

To maintain the same purchasing power as $75,000 in Glendale, you'd need roughly $41,935/year in Phuket. This is based on the overall COL index difference.
